Yacht Broker Roger Allison
Roger learned how to sail an O’Day 28 while in high school on Smith Mountain Lake, Virginia. During college, he sailed a Morgan OI 40 from Miami-based Dinner Key Marina throughout the Keys and Bahamas. Since this early age, he earned multiple ASA certifications (e.g., bareboating/cruising, diesel engine repair, navigation) and completed all related USCG Auxiliary courses.

Roger has sailed or served as charter Captain in the Chesapeake Bay, Narragansett Bay, Buzzards Bay, Martha’s Vineyard, Nantucket, Bermuda, Florida Keys, Bahamas, BVIs, USVIs, Leeward Islands (St Maarten, Anguilla, St Kitts/Nevis, St. Bart, Antigua) and the Great Salt Lake. He has offshore raced in Mt Gay-sponsored regattas (e.g., Newport-Bermuda, Barbados, Antigua, Tortola) as well as stateside regatta’s (DC, New York, Chesapeake Bay).

His proudest accomplishment was assisting the launch of DC Sail, a Washington, DC-based 501-C3 enabling 500 underprivileged children to learn the engineering, confidence, discipline, and joy of sailing. He assisted in the fundraising and acquisition of a fleet of Flying Scots and Lasers for the training classes and regattas.

His Pearson 40 (Ted Hood designed centerboard), Dances with Waves, has been docked on Dock C in Annapolis and Moored in Bristol, RI. He is also proficient with power boats/motor yachts (34-47 feet) and has delivered several from Annapolis to Newport RI as well as chartering many throughout the Caribbean islands. Roger is a current member of the Western Carolina Sailing Club.

Roger was a successful business executive starting 9 technology-based companies (1 IPO, 4 acquisitions and 2 are still in business). He is also a licensed South Carolina Realtor so can assist in the purchase of dock space or onshore waterfront homes.
